Orchard t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ping fruit trees to promote healthy growth and maximize fruit production. This process includes removing dead, damaged, or diseased branches, thinning out crowded areas, and shaping the canopy to allow better sunlight penetration and air circulation. Proper pruning not only helps maintain the tree’s structure but also encourages stronger branches, reduces the risk of limb breakage, and supports the overall vitality of the tree. Homeowners with fruit trees or ornamental trees often seek these services to ensure their trees remain healthy and productive over the years.

Pruning addresses several common problems that can affect the health and appearance of trees. Overgrown branches can lead to poor air flow and increased susceptibility to pests and diseases. Dead or broken limbs may pose safety hazards or cause further damage if left untrimmed. Additionally, poorly shaped trees can become unbalanced, leading to uneven growth or potential falling hazards during storms. Regular pruning helps resolve these issues by removing problematic branches early, preventing more serious problems in the future, and maintaining the safety and aesthetic appeal of the property.

The overview below groups typical Orchard Tree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Sioux Falls, SD.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Small Tree Pruning - Typical costs range from $250 to $600 for routine pruning of small to medium-sized trees. Many local pros handle these jobs regularly within this range, which covers basic trimming and shaping. Larger or more complex small tree projects can occasionally exceed this range.

Moderate Tree Pruning - For more extensive pruning of larger trees or multiple trees, costs generally fall between $600 and $1,500. Many projects of this scale are common in the area, with fewer reaching into the higher end of this range for specialty work or difficult access.

Large Tree Pruning - Larger, more complex pruning jobs, such as crown thinning or removal of hazardous branches, can range from $1,500 to $3,000. These projects are less frequent but are handled regularly by experienced local contractors for safety and health reasons.

Full Tree Removal - Complete removal of a mature or hazardous tree typically costs $2,500 to $5,000 or more, depending on size and location. While many routine pruning jobs fall into lower tiers, full removals are less common but handled by specialists for complex or large trees.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
